AUDITIONS FOR A NEW PLAY AT ENGLISH THEATRE LEIPZIG

Something Wicked
(a metaplay)
Double, double toil and trouble,
fire burn and cauldron bubble.

Ingredients
Take the three witches of Macbeth, put them in their own West End play with a famous womanizing director, add a hint of techno, several tabs of MDMA, a twist of postmodernism, a sprinkling of dark comedy and a generous serving of deception.

Stir.

Presentation Tips
Serve with a Shakespearean and contemporary tongue.
As always, revenge is a dish best served cold.

AUDITION DETAILS

EMILY (witch 1 / actress), 20s. A starlet both striking and strident. Her boldness masks a deeper sensitivity. Macauley's lover and ex-student. We see her both in rehearsal and off.

FELICITY (witch 2 / actress), 20s. Delicate & soulful. Macauley's step-daughter. We see her both in rehearsal and off.

ALEX (witch 3 / actor), 20s. Male / female / non-binary. Androgynous, a natural inhabitant of the Berlin club scene. Still waters run deep. We see them both in rehearsal and off. They are having a secret affair with Macauley.

BILLIE (theatre technician). Any age or gender. An awkward introvert. A skulking but insistent shadow. We hear their voice (from the back of the auditorium) more than we see them.

MACAULEY (director / Macbeth). 50ish. Commands the stage, both professionally & physically. A benevolent but deceitful force, occasionally tortured by his own conscience. An actor in his own right.
